Understanding Grain Marketing

To begin our journey, let’s establish a clear understanding of what grain marketing entails. Grain marketing refers to the process of selling and distributing grains produced by farmers. It involves determining when and where to sell grains, assessing market conditions, and optimizing prices for maximum profit.

The Dynamics of Grain Pricing

Grain prices are influenced by a myriad of factors, including weather conditions, global demand, and geopolitical events. Understanding these factors is key to making informed decisions. For example, extreme weather events can affect crop yields, leading to fluctuations in grain prices. Similarly, changes in international trade agreements can impact export opportunities, affecting the demand for grains.

Strategies for Successful Grain Marketing

Now that we’ve established the importance of grain marketing let’s delve into some strategies for success:

Market Analysis: Regularly monitor market trends and keep an eye on current grain marketing prices. Utilize reputable sources like the USDA or commodity market reports to stay informed.

Diversification: Don’t put all your grains in one basket. Diversify your marketing strategies by exploring different selling options, such as cash sales, futures contracts, or forward contracts.

Risk Management: Implement risk management tools like crop insurance to protect against unexpected losses due to factors like adverse weather conditions.

Storage Management: Properly store your grains to maintain their quality and prevent spoilage. This allows you to choose when to sell based on favorable market conditions.

Contracting: Consider entering into contracts with buyers to secure prices in advance. This can provide price stability and reduce market risk.
